Understanding Crypto Exchange Fees
Before diving into the specifics, it's vital to understand the various kinds of fees that Crypto Exchanges With Lowest Fees exchanges normally enforce:
Trading Fees: These are the fees charged for performing a trade. They can be charged as a portion of the trade quantity or a flat fee.Withdrawal Fees: Exchanges typically charge a fee for moving your funds off their platform. This fee differs based on the cryptocurrency being withdrawn.Deposit Fees: Some exchanges may charge a fee for depositing funds, although lots of do not.Lack of exercise Fees: Some platforms impose fees on accounts that remain non-active for a certain duration.
By understanding these fees, traders can select an exchange that lines up with their trading practices and financial goals.

Ensure to read the fine print before dedicating to a platform.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the distinction in between trading fees and withdrawal fees?
Trading fees are incurred when you purchase or sell cryptocurrency on an exchange, while withdrawal fees are charged when you move your cryptocurrency off the exchange to another wallet.
2. How can I lower my trading fees?
The majority of exchanges offer discount rates for utilizing their native token to pay for fees. In addition, trading in larger volumes frequently leads to lower fees.
3. Is a higher trading fee always a negative?
Not always. A higher fee might be justified if the exchange uses superior features, security, customer assistance, or reliability.
4. Are there any exchanges without fees?
While some platforms may provide zero trading fees on specified trades or promos, they typically compensate for this through greater withdrawal fees or other charges.
5. Can I trust exchanges with low fees?
Low Fee Crypto Exchange fees do not constantly relate to an absence of security or service. Research the exchange's reputation, user evaluations, and regulatory compliance to guarantee they are credible.
